First, I'm by no means an expert on tarpon fishing. However, there are lots Tarpon inshore right now. You can kayak out past the second sand bar and see them. Getting them to bite is another matter.

They seem to be cruising through on their way to feeding grounds around Indian Pass. I'm told they prefer feeding over a grass bottom, which we don't have around here.

i think you should be able to kayak at least to the second sand bar and throw out a mullet or some sort of batefish or even a cut bait. you can then throw that out there and sit for a while in your kayak because they would need to pick up a scent trail. you might want to take water or something out there with you and then get ready for the ride of your life. you could also take another rod with a large lure that resembles a baitfish in case you see a tarpon roll. if you cast out a baitfish or cut bait you want to use a lot of line but i wouldnt recommend a metal leader because the tarpon can sometimes get spooked by it. good luck
